OK burst weapons, they do have a lot of those. Did you make any enemies on the surface, like rescue the girl? Do anything that might rile up the gang later.

That way the gang stays peaceful, and you say your name is Pat, but with low speech, that may not work. A low speech character must have high sneak skill to control how many enemies come at you in combat. Usually I steal the chems off the lvl 1 guards, esp. the guy with the psycho before any combat. 2 Psycho and some stims can get you thru this if they don't get a lucky armor piercing critical. Aim for the head to knock them down so you can take their stuff during combat. and eyes for the kill.

I just loaded up a game and did the vault 15 quests again with purely an hth character whose not Pat. It can be done, if you can sneak past the lower guards and get to the docs med bay, that doorway can keep most of them out while you work them over 1 at a time. Chems are great in this game, they require a bit of figuring out to get the benefits so most people ignore them. They can be used for improving skills on the downside, as well as combat/perks on the upside. They can improve (or nerf) your companions stats as well on a semi permanent basis.
